There is not a direct bus from Dale, IN to Jamestown, OH.

There is a bus stop in Dale, IN, but not one in Jamestown, OH. The closest bus stop from Jamestown, OH is in Springfield, OH, which is around 18 miles away.

There may be a bus schedule from Dale, IN to Springfield, OH.

The population of Dale, IN is 1,442

Dale, IN is in Spencer county.

The population of Jamestown, OH is 3,685

Jamestown, OH is in Greene county.
